Output 032dd23c978729e97b05da6c667b3da810cb84775604a21404a806b0792b6927:5

value
28180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f642c04675436100f46fa93fdcbf280b2d883d OP_EQUAL
address
3DuLoZ5Ki2a9NvGVcCyorLZVS3Dd8KypMU
transaction
032dd23c978729e97b05da6c667b3da810cb84775604a21404a806b0792b6927
confirmations
449755
spent
true